Date: April 6, 1995
Product: ARCserve for NetWare
Version: 5.01g
Module: FSTAPE
-------------------------------------------------------------------------------

Issue(s) Addressed:
1. More than 300 (approximately) space restrictions for a volume using 
        SMS LOGIC FOR DOS AND MAC FILES=YES would cause the volume not 
        to be backed up.
2. Volume block size was not set correctly if any volume had a different
        block size than the first, causing files to be backed up 
        incorrectly as a sparse file if FULL SMS was not used. 
        This only affects the host server backup.  The message "Pack
        sparse file" would appear in the Activity Log.  These files
        cannot be restored properly.
3. The error message "E3011 Failed to open file SYS:\ARCSERVE\BA3000.BSA"
        may be erroneously displayed.  It is an ARCserve temp file.


Notes and Warnings: (if necessary)
ARCserve 5.01g must be installed before using this file.


Packing List:
FSTAPE.NLM 5.01g (004)


Installation Instructions:
Rename the FSTAPE.NLM in the NLM subdirectory in ARCserve Home Directory.
Copy the new FSTAPE.NLM to the same directory.
